The movie takes place on a remote island, where a group of friends, all in their mid-twenties, have gathered for a weekend getaway. The group consists of Pete (Pete Davidson), Sophie (Amandla Stenberg), Alice (Haley Lu Richardson), and others. As they spend their days partying and getting to know each other, they decide to play a game called "Bodies Bodies Bodies," where they have to find each other in the dark and accuse one another of being a killer.
